Sorry, I didn't mean to sound negative, or even unhelpful...
I actually know the answer, I'm pretty sure. When your book goes to premium channels through Smashwords they show up as the publisher. It may well be a requirement due their own responsibility either to you (to protect your work) or some part of their agreement with the premium channels. A lot of things are allowed onto Smashwords that don't meet the requirements for their premium distribution...I have two books currently they want me to change and we are going back and forth over - though in those cases it's formatting. I'm guessing when they said it was not required they meant to be on Smashwords, but not for Premium distribution. They are pretty overwhelmed, but they usually do answer questions. |

From my experience, they simply require any license notice at all. I've put in stuff like:
Smashwords Edition, License Notes Take and enjoy! and they've gone through. |
